The Four LED States

The Four LED States — What Each One Means and What It Requires in Lafourche Crossing, LA

State One — Both LEDs Solid — Sensor System Not the Cause in Lafourche Crossing

Both sensor LEDs solid indicates the transmitter is producing the infrared beam and the receiver is correctly detecting it in Lafourche Crossing, LA. The sensor system is functioning correctly in Lafourche Crossing. If the door still won't close with both LEDs solid, the sensor system is not the cause of the won't-close symptom in Lafourche Crossing, LA. EZ Open moves to the next step in the won't-close diagnostic hierarchy in Lafourche Crossing. Down-travel limit setting assessment. Physical obstruction check. Spring balance and force limit assessment in Lafourche Crossing, LA.

State Two — Receiver LED Blinking, Transmitter LED Solid — Misalignment or Obstruction in Lafourche Crossing, LA

The transmitter is producing the beam, its LED is solid, in Lafourche Crossing. The receiver isn't correctly detecting the full beam, its LED is blinking, in Lafourche Crossing, LA. This state indicates one of three possible causes in Lafourche Crossing. The receiver sensor bracket has rotated out of correct alignment and the beam isn't hitting the receiver lens. A physical obstruction between the two sensors is blocking the beam in Lafourche Crossing, LA. Or sunlight is hitting the receiver lens at an angle that overwhelms the receiver's ability to detect the transmitter's beam against the solar background in Lafourche Crossing.

State Three — Receiver LED Off, Transmitter LED Solid — Wiring or Power Fault at Receiver in Lafourche Crossing

The transmitter has power, its LED is solid, in Lafourche Crossing, LA. The receiver has no power, its LED is completely off, in Lafourche Crossing. A completely off LED indicates no power reaching the sensor unit in Lafourche Crossing, LA. The most common cause is a break in the wiring between the receiver sensor and the opener control board in Lafourche Crossing. The break may be from a staple driven through the wire during installation, a rodent chew, a physical disturbance that kinked or cut the wire, or a loose connection at the control board terminal in Lafourche Crossing, LA.

State Four — Both LEDs Off — No Power to Either Sensor in Lafourche Crossing, LA

Both LEDs off indicates no power reaching either sensor in Lafourche Crossing. The most common cause is a loose or disconnected connection at the sensor terminal on the opener control board where both sensor wires connect in Lafourche Crossing, LA. Both sensors share the same power supply from the opener in Lafourche Crossing. If the connection that supplies power to both sensors is loose or disconnected, both sensors lose power simultaneously in Lafourche Crossing, LA.

The Bracket Adjustment Test

The Bracket Adjustment Test — How EZ Open Distinguishes Misalignment From Failure in Lafourche Crossing, LA

What the Bracket Adjustment Test Involves in Lafourche Crossing

The bracket adjustment test is performed when the receiver LED is blinking and no physical obstruction is visible between the two sensors in Lafourche Crossing, LA. The receiver sensor bracket is gently adjusted through its complete range of angular positions while the receiver LED is continuously observed in Lafourche Crossing. The bracket is moved through every angle at which the receiver lens could potentially receive the transmitter's beam in Lafourche Crossing, LA. The test takes approximately sixty to ninety seconds to complete through the full bracket range in Lafourche Crossing.

What a Positive Result Tells Us — The Sensor Is Functional in Lafourche Crossing, LA

If the receiver LED becomes solid at any point during the bracket adjustment, at any angle within the bracket's range of motion, the sensor's internal photoelectric component is functional in Lafourche Crossing. The sensor is correctly detecting the transmitter's beam when the beam is correctly aligned with the receiver lens in Lafourche Crossing, LA. The cause of the blinking LED was misalignment of the bracket rather than failure of the sensor component in Lafourche Crossing. The bracket is locked in the position where the LED became solid in Lafourche Crossing, LA. No sensor replacement is needed in Lafourche Crossing.

What a Negative Result Tells Us — The Sensor Has Failed in Lafourche Crossing, LA

If the receiver LED stays blinking through the complete range of bracket adjustment with no physical obstruction between the sensors in Lafourche Crossing, the sensor's internal photoelectric component has failed in Lafourche Crossing, LA. The component isn't detecting the transmitter's beam at any angle because it can no longer detect infrared radiation at the transmitter's frequency in Lafourche Crossing. The sensor requires replacement in Lafourche Crossing, LA. EZ Open carries compatible replacement sensors for all major opener brands in Lafourche Crossing.

Sensor Bracket Misalignment From Physical Contact or Vibration in Lafourche Crossing

The sensor bracket is designed to be adjustable for installation in Lafourche Crossing, LA. That adjustability also means the bracket can rotate out of correct alignment from physical contact with a person, object, or vehicle that bumps the sensor or the bracket during garage use in Lafourche Crossing. Door operation vibration over years of cycling can also slowly rotate the bracket away from its correct angle in Lafourche Crossing, LA. The bracket adjustment test confirms misalignment as the cause in Lafourche Crossing. Bracket adjustment and locking in the correct position resolves the fault in Lafourche Crossing, LA.

Physical Obstruction Between the Sensors in Lafourche Crossing

An object positioned in the path between the two sensors at floor level blocks the infrared beam and produces the same blinking receiver LED as misalignment in Lafourche Crossing, LA. A tool, a piece of equipment, a floor mat shifted into the path, or debris accumulation at the door threshold in Lafourche Crossing. Removing the obstruction restores correct beam transmission in Lafourche Crossing, LA.

Solar Interference — The Time-of-Day Fault in Lafourche Crossing, LA

Direct sunlight entering the garage can contain sufficient infrared radiation to overwhelm the receiver's ability to detect the transmitter's specific beam against the solar background in Lafourche Crossing. The symptom occurs only when the sun is at a specific angle that directs sunlight onto the receiver lens in Lafourche Crossing, LA. The time-of-day pattern is the identifying characteristic in Lafourche Crossing. A door that won't close in the afternoon but closes correctly in the morning and evening is almost certainly experiencing solar interference in Lafourche Crossing, LA.

Wiring Fault Between Sensor and Opener Control Board in Lafourche Crossing

The low-voltage wiring connecting each sensor to the opener control board runs from the sensor bracket up the door frame and along the ceiling to the opener unit in Lafourche Crossing, LA. Any break, short circuit, or poor connection along this run produces sensor LED behavior that appears identical to sensor misalignment or failure in Lafourche Crossing. EZ Open inspects the complete wiring run where an off LED or persistent blinking LED doesn't respond to bracket adjustment in Lafourche Crossing, LA.

Sensor Component Failure — When Replacement Is Actually Required in Lafourche Crossing, LA

A sensor with a failed internal photoelectric component requires replacement in Lafourche Crossing. The component failure is confirmed by the negative result of the bracket adjustment test, the receiver LED stays blinking through the complete bracket range with no obstruction between the sensors in Lafourche Crossing, LA. Replacement with a compatible sensor for the specific opener brand restores correct function in Lafourche Crossing.

Opener Control Board Fault Producing Sensor-Like Symptoms in Lafourche Crossing, LA

In specific cases, a fault in the opener control board itself produces symptoms that appear identical to a sensor fault in Lafourche Crossing. The board may incorrectly interpret the sensor signal as a beam interruption when the sensor is correctly functioning in Lafourche Crossing, LA. EZ Open identifies control board involvement through elimination of all sensor-level causes in Lafourche Crossing.

Sensors are required to be installed no higher than six inches from the floor to ensure they can detect a small child or pet in the door's path in Lafourche Crossing. Raising them significantly higher to avoid a low bumper would compromise this safety function and isn't something EZ Open recommends or performs in Lafourche Crossing, LA. If a low-clearance vehicle is repeatedly triggering a reversal, the better solution is adjusting how the vehicle is parked relative to the sensor beam rather than relocating the sensors in Lafourche Crossing.
A sensor problem typically causes the door to reverse mid-close, since it's detecting an interrupted beam during the closing cycle in Lafourche Crossing. A limit switch problem typically causes the door to stop short of the floor, or to fail to fully open, without necessarily reversing, since it's related to where the opener registers the door's travel boundaries in Lafourche Crossing, LA. EZ Open distinguishes between the two through the specific symptom pattern, where the door stops versus whether it reverses in Lafourche Crossing.
